Output f9d5845c890ca4856d0d51b73959af8a5e9ee01ec789d10bf27ff5ade8df7b07:2

value
17689269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3d4af105d3e4d31b0d6e841f3e204d19a2b2954 OP_EQUAL
address
3M15HYzofGefU5VirQ8tw4yEBomcXMGL3e
transaction
f9d5845c890ca4856d0d51b73959af8a5e9ee01ec789d10bf27ff5ade8df7b07
confirmations
283379
spent
true